Is Dr. Henry Guilty Under Criminal Code?

Dr. Bonnie Henry

Is Dr. Henry Guilty?

The criminal code of Canada clearly states:

176(2) Every one who wilfully disturbs or interrupts an assemblage of persons met for religious worship or for a moral, social or benevolent purpose is guilty of an offence punishable on summary conviction.

It would be interesting to see the outcome if churches in B.C. were to swear out a complaint against Dr. Henry under this section of the Criminal Code. Then she would have to explain why church assemblies are more dangerous than going to Costco, or a restaurant or the liquor store.
